
Registered user since Mon 11 Dec 2017
Name:Thomas Ball
Country:United States
Affiliation:Microsoft Research
Personal website: http://research.microsoft.com/en-us/people/tball/
Contributions
ICSE 2019-profile
View general profile
View general profile